APPENDIX – SOFTWARE CONFIGURATION AND PROGRAMMING PROCEDURES 

 

For set-up and adjustment of the detector, the following additional items are necessary: 
 

1 personal computer (Windows

®

 operating system) 

1 USB-RS485 converter 
1 mini-USB cable 
1 software 
 

Installation of the USB-RS485 converter 
 

Connect the USB-RS485 converter to the computer. 
 
The proper device driver(s) for the specific operating system version in use can be determined and 
downloaded via the following link: 
 

http://www.ftdichip.com/FTDrivers.htm

 

 
After successful installation, the COM-port 
assigned to the converter can be verified.
